![]() I had the same thing happen to my car right after i bought it. I was driving up the road and the car started surging a little, but it didn' stop there. It ran fine for another five minutes, then i went to hit the gas and nothing happened, when i pushed in the clutch the rpm's dropped to zero and the car wouldn't start. I let it sit, banged on the gas tank and it worked fine again, for a while. I ended up replacing the fuel pump and it hasn't givin me a problem since.
